Legality of a bioethanol fireplace

There are many questions about the legality of freestanding bioethanol fireplaces. First, you might be wondering what kind of restrictions exist. Although bioethanol is a renewable energy source, it still has to follow the same regulations as any other fuel. It is best to keep it away from children and pets, and in a cool, dry location. It must also be handled carefully when filling the fireplace and spills must be cleaned up quickly. The good thing is that bioethanol is simpler to find than traditional fuel. It is readily available in large fireplace and home supply stores.

A bio ethanol-freestanding fire is not legal unless it's been examined by an accredited testing institute. For example, if the product has been approved by TUV This means that it is safe to use. You should not leave a bio ethanol fireplace unattended. Bioethanol is flammable in hot areas. It's recommended to open the windows when it's a bit suffocating, however it should never be left unattended.

The legality of a bioethanol freestanding fireplace is contingent on where you reside and where you purchased it from. It is important to research the local regulations to determine if ethanol fireplaces in your region are legal. If you're not sure, call your local building and safety department to determine. You can buy a product that meets all requirements if it's found it.

Generallyspeaking, freestanding bioethanol fireplaces aren't any more dangerous than domestic fire systems. Keep flammable materials at least 1500mm away from the fire, and don't place the fireplace in close proximity to gas that is flammable. Additionally you should not use bioethanol fireplaces for cooking.

Benefits of bioethanol fireplaces

A bio ethanol freestanding fire is an excellent choice for your fireplace. It doesn't require a chimney in order to work and produces no smoke. It's a healthier option since it utilizes plants as fuel instead of fossil fuels and does not damage the environment. Bioethanol is a source of renewable energy that is derived from the conversion of sun's energy into. Bioethanol is a great alternative for fossil fuels, as it doesn't require the removal of trees.

Bio-ethanol fuel has an additional benefit It burns cleanly and doesn't leave smoke or Ash. It's also more efficient than conventional fuel which means it generates less pollutants in the air than traditional fuels. This makes it a good choice for those suffering from allergies or health conditions.

Bio-ethanol fireplaces are not only green, but they're also extremely simple to install. They're constructed of strong stainless steel, bio ethanol freestanding fire which means they won't damage your home or chimney. They can be put anywhere, even in areas without power and can be moved wherever you want. There are even portable versions designed for outdoor use.

Using a bio-ethanol fireplace is easy. You just need to adhere to the basic safety rules. First, you should not add fuel to an open flame. The open flame can be dangerous and it's important to know how to deal with it. You don't want to end up with a burnt foot or hand!

In addition to being environmentally friendly, a bio-ethanol fireplace can be less expensive than a traditional electric fireplace. It can be more practical, easy to use and appealing. Bio-ethanol fireplaces can be a great choice for renters and city dwellers with limited space. A freestanding bio-ethanol fireplace is portable and simple to use, which is ideal for people renting homes or apartments.

Cost of a bioethanol fireplace

Before purchasing a freestanding bioethanol fire place be aware of the cost of operating it. There are a lot of variables to take into account, such as how often you plan to use your fire. The frequency at which you plan to use the fire will also affect how much fuel it costs.

The cost of a bio ethanol freestanding fire is a lot of different. The price of a bio ethanol freestanding fire can vary from a few hundred dollars up to several thousand dollars. Since there isn't a standard cost for these fireplaces, the costs will differ greatly. It is possible to find cheap ones, however, the quality may not be as high as higher-end models.

A bioethanol-freestanding fireplace is priced according to its size and features. Prefabricated models that are recessed only cost $500-$7,500, while custom-made ones could cost as high as $15,000 and even more. Prefabricated bioethanol fireplaces are cheaper than custom-built ones, Bio ethanol freestanding fire but you might need to move your gas line to place them in your space. You can also buy a bioethanol fireplace that has smart technology that is connected to your smartphone. You can control the fireplace via remote and even program it to run on its own when you're not around. You shouldn't leave a bioethanol fireplace running without supervision.

Bioethanol-freestanding fireplaces also enjoy the advantage of being mobile. They can be easily moved from one place to another and also between outdoor and indoor spaces. Many models come with wheels to allow for easy portability. You can mix and match different sizes and colors to make the perfect fireplace.
